The launch of DFY Suite 7.0 has certainly created a considerable deal of interest within the internet marketing community. But does it truly match the promises? This thorough review tries to uncover what DFY Suite 7.0 https://sachingszm923025.blogminds.com/dfy-suite-7-review-does-it-worth-the-hype-36257887